Descriptive Gazetteer Entry for BRAUNCEWELL-WITH-DUNSBY, or Branswell-with-Dunsby

BRAUNCEWELL-WITH-DUNSBY, or Branswell-with-Dunsby, a parish in Sleaford district, Lincoln; 4½ miles NNW of Sleaford r. station. Post Town, Sleaford. Acres, 3,470. Real property, £4,828. Pop., 112. Houses, 18. The property is divided among a few. The living is a rectory, united with the vicarage of Anwick, in the diocese of Lincoln. Value, £715.* Patrons, alternately the Marquis of Bristol and Mrs. H. Robinson. The church is good.


(John Marius Wilson, Imperial Gazetteer of England and Wales (1870-72))
